you know what really bothers me

At the end of Fist Of Fury, Bruce Lee jumps toward the police, doing his classic kick pose. The screen freezes and fades to black, and we hear the police shooting, sending the suggestion that he’s committed suicide by cop.

However, there is a whole gang of people standing only about twenty feet behind him. His girl, the other students of the schools, the Japanese consul. All those people are directly in the line of fire. No doubt he thought he was being selfless in his sacrifice, or maybe it was straight hubris, but it’s pretty well a guarantee that at least a couple of the people beside him, the woman he loves, a major diplomat, got shot, possibly fatally.

Jerk move, Bruce Lee. Jerk move.
